Buy/Sell/Trade TIPS - read before posting
labeling your subject:
to keep this forum easy to navigate through, please be sure to put either an "FS" ("for sale") or a "WTB" ("wanted to buy") or "T" ("trade") before each subject heading...
if you're only selling something locally only, feel free to add your city as well.
ex. FS: NYC: Shure SM57
editing your posts:
you are always able to edit your posts but if someone comments on your thread you will not be able to delete thread.
post responsibly:
we won't delete a thread if something sells. please either change the subject heading and include "SOLD" after the original subject heading (ex. FS: NYC: Shure SM57-SOLD), or, post a "sold" comment to the thread.
scammers:
be smart when buying/selling/trading - get as much info as you can about the person/s you are doing business with. the TOMB is in no way to be held responsible for any scam posts/users/etc.

Maybe a good idea to encourage sellers to include a geographical abbreviation in their title (e.g., PDX or OR), especially for local pick-up items. I'm sure it would be asking too much to be able to search/sort posts (in any forum) by geographical distance. But it would be handy to know when someone you're communicating with is actually close enough for a visit.

FS:Crown 712 tape recorder: NYC
1961 Crown tape recorder model 712 in good working order for sale in New York City. I have the book for it as well. Features 3 motor transport, 3 speeds: 15,71/2, 3 3/4). It has 3 speed equalization, patented differential magnetic braking, 10 1/2 inch reel capacity and more. Best offer. Shipping possible but a local sale is more realistic.
